Brief Biography
Dr. Andrew Dellinger joined the faculty of Elon University in Fall 2013. He is currently teaching STS 1100. He has also performed statistical analysis for phase I clinical cancer trials at Duke University, and developed new statistical methods for pathway analysis and survival analysis in cancer and NAFLD. From 2018 to the present, he has been performing statistical analyses to discover reasons for liver injury due to prescription medications, herbs, and dietary supplements. He graduated with his Ph.D. in Bioinformatics from NCSU in 2006, with his B.S. in Computer Science from NCSU in 2000, and with his B.S. in Pharmacy from UNC-Chapel Hill in 1997. He is a native of Hickory, North Carolina.

Research
Performed statistical analyses on drug-induced liver injury studies, using SAS, R, Perl, and genetic/bioinformatic software. Fisher exact tests, chi-square tests, t-tests, logistic regression, Firth regression, haplotype analysis, GWAS, genetic imputation, and other methods were used in this research.
Performed statistical analyses on phase I and II clinical cancer drug trials, and contract
work for pharmaceutical companies. Collaborated with and presented to oncologists, lab
personnel, and biostatisticians. Script and pipeline development using SAS and R. Used
mixed models, hazard ratios, survival analyses, longitudinal data analysis, Kaplan-Meier,
Cox regression, graphics, and macros in SAS, JMP, and R. Report writing to Pfizer, Tracon
Pharmaceuticals.
Developed two statistical methods coded in R, including a pathway-based –omics data integration method and interpretation of pathways distinguishing dichotomous variables. Handled multiple tasks and projects, scoping and estimating resources, then executing on the analysis of projects
Led design and deployment of statistical approaches on sequencing, PCR, gene
expression, copy number variant (CNV), and association (GWAS) data for human genetics
studies on large datasets. Analyses included data processing, data management, and data
analysis. Taught and mentored personnel. Software development (planning, coding,
testing, documentation, and debugging) of SNPSelector (Perl, HTML, SQL, PHP) and a
Java GUI for CNV analysis and visualization. Script, program, and pipeline development on
all projects using Perl, SAS, SQL (Oracle and Access), and/or R.
Studied the evolution of sequence, structure, and function in the Ras protein superfamily.
Used multiple sequence alignment programs such as BLAST, BLAT, CLUSTALW, and
DiAlign. Used factor analysis, motifs, data mining, 3D protein models, and multiple
multivariate statistical methods.
Helped develop a genetic database tool that predicts restriction enzyme fragments at the
genome level and implements other methods meant to aid genetics research. Developed a
HTML and Visual web interface for this database.
